prime effectiveness needs for Solar Cleaning Robot Batteries
Solar cleaning robots demand a battery Resolution that delivers consistent functionality and longevity. High-potential Lithium Batteries are crucial to ensure prolonged operational time, making it possible for the robotic to scrub a larger area spot on an individual charge. body weight is also a big issue, as lighter batteries Increase the robot’s maneuverability and reduce have on and tear on the cleansing system. Moreover, these batteries need to resist severe environmental problems, which include extreme temperatures, dust, and humidity. quickly charging capabilities are also necessary to decrease downtime and optimize efficiency. A robust Battery administration procedure (BMS) is critical to avoid overcharging, deep discharging, and overheating, making certain the protection and longevity of your battery.
Comparing Lithium Battery Technologies for Automated Solar servicing
numerous lithium battery technologies can be obtained, Every single with its have benefits and drawbacks. Lithium Iron Phosphate (LiFePO4) batteries are noted for their exceptional security, long lifespan, and thermal balance, earning them ideal for demanding purposes like solar cleansing robots. Lithium-ion (Li-ion) batteries supply high energy density but may call for more refined thermal management methods. Lithium Polymer (LiPo) batteries are lightweight and can be molded into several shapes, but These are normally fewer strong and also have a shorter lifespan than LiFePO4 batteries. When picking a battery technologies, think about the distinct working situations, general performance necessities, and basic safety issues of the photo voltaic cleansing robotic. LiFePO4 typically emerges as the popular selection resulting from its stability of functionality, safety, and longevity.
